
Put
simply, any Travel Bug (or Geocoin) arriving at a Stargate TB Cache
can be rapidly transported to another Stargate TB Cache for
eventual pickup.
STARGATE TRAVELLERS WILL REQUIRE A
WORMHOLE ACTIVATION CODE (WAC) IN ORDER TO BE ALLOWED ACCESS TO THE
STARGATE. THIS CODE WILL BE IN THE FORM ‘PXXXX’. THE
‘XXXX’ PORTION IS THE ACTUAL ADDRESS OF THE STARGATE
WHICH THE TRAVELLER WISHES TO VISIT. FILL OUT THE PAPERWORK WITH
THE CORRECT ADDRESS AND SOON THE TRAVELLER WILL BE ON ITS WAY!
FORMS ARE PROVIDED AT THE STARGATE HOLDING AREA (CACHE).
If the TB is left without a valid Stargate
address, or has an invalid address, it will be transported to a
cache that best advances its goal (in the cache owner’s
opinion).
If travel via the Stargate Network will hinder the TB's goal(s),
the TB's travel orders will be revoked. If a TB owner doesn’t
want their TB to travel the Stargate network, quickly contact me
(ArcticNomad)
and I will revoke its traveling orders.
If the cacher dropping off the TB doesn’t want the TB to
travel the Stargate network, include this information in the cache
log (both logbook and web). The TB will be assigned local support
duty, and will investigate local caches for alien activity.

Please pick up only arriving Travel Bugs, or
Bugs that are NOT permitted to travel through the
StarGate.
That is, if you find a Travel Bug that is
waiting for transport to another Stargate TB Cache, please leave it
in the cache.
While this cache is themed to Travel Bugs/Geocoins, there is still
a log and trade goods to welcome all geocachers.
The cache container is an ammo box. Please
make every effort to re-hide well, and remember that StarGate
locations are supposed to be kept VERY
TOPSECRET!!
